Add skaspari@mozilla.com (Sebastian Kaspari) to vpn_tooltooleditors

RESOLVED FIXED

Status

Release Engineering
General
RESOLVED FIXED
3 years ago
3 years ago

People

(Reporter: nalexander, Unassigned)

Tracking

Firefox Tracking Flags

(Not tracked)

Details

(Reporter)

Description

3 years ago
Hi folks, Sebastian needs upload permissions to tooltool.  Thanks!
My employee address is skaspari@mozilla.com. If this needs to be connected to the account I have commit access with then that's s.kaspari@gmail.com.
Summary: Add sebastian@mozilla.com (Sebastian Kaspari) to vpn_tooltooleditors → Add skaspari@mozilla.com (Sebastian Kaspari) to vpn_tooltooleditors
Hey Sebastian,

I have just granted this role for you, with Nick's vouch.

Once the LDAP propogates (usually less than 30 minutes) you should logout and re-login to api.pub.mozilla.org (if you were already logged in).

The instructions for how to upload to tooltool is at https://wiki.mozilla.org/ReleaseEngineering/Applications/Tooltool#How_to_upload_to_tooltool

And you don't actually need to be on VPN anymore.
Assignee: vpn-acl → nobody
Status: NEW → RESOLVED
Last Resolved: 3 years ago
Component: Mozilla VPN: ACL requests → Other
Product: Infrastructure & Operations → Release Engineering
QA Contact: dparsons → mshal
Resolution: --- → FIXED
Thank you!
(Reporter)

Comment 4

3 years ago
Callek: can you grant Sebastian tooltool.{upload,download}.* rights?  Thanks!
Status: RESOLVED → REOPENED
Flags: needinfo?(bugspam.Callek)
Resolution: FIXED → ---
Sebastian, you should have these rights automatically.

Are you logging in with your skaspari@mozilla.com and did a full logout/login since c#2 ?
Flags: needinfo?(bugspam.Callek) → needinfo?(s.kaspari)
(In reply to Justin Wood (:Callek) from comment #5)
> Sebastian, you should have these rights automatically.
> 
> Are you logging in with your skaspari@mozilla.com and did a full
> logout/login since c#2 ?

With skaspari@mozilla.com I just get: "Can't Do Much! You can't see or issue tokens". With s.kaspari@gmail.com I get some options but not the once to upload/download (internal).
Flags: needinfo?(s.kaspari) → needinfo?(bugspam.Callek)
(In reply to Sebastian Kaspari (:sebastian) from comment #6)
> (In reply to Justin Wood (:Callek) from comment #5)
> > Sebastian, you should have these rights automatically.
> > 
> > Are you logging in with your skaspari@mozilla.com and did a full
> > logout/login since c#2 ?
> 
> With skaspari@mozilla.com I just get: "Can't Do Much! You can't see or issue
> tokens". With s.kaspari@gmail.com I get some options but not the once to
> upload/download (internal).

Ahh I found our issues.

The "can you upload to tooltool" permission list didn't include the "I can create tokens" but the "can you push code" one did. Though that latter one for you didn't have the bit for tooltool uploads.

I just made sure the token creation is enabled for all of "team_moco" and all of "vpn_tooltooleditor" LDAP groups as well now, so we shouldn't hit this problem again.

Though again, it will require a logout/login for the changes to take affect.
Flags: needinfo?(bugspam.Callek)
Now it works. Thank you!

Updated

3 years ago
Status: REOPENED → RESOLVED
Last Resolved: 3 years ago3 years ago
Resolution: --- → FIXED
You need to log in before you can comment on or make changes to this bug.